The best overall

Samsung Galaxy S20 Plus

Samsung Galaxy S20 Plus

Why you should buy it: This is a thin and light smartphone with an incredible screen, a camera that offers excellent results in most environments and excellent battery life.

Who’s it for : Any user looking for the latest in mobile technology from Samsung.

The phone is neither too big nor too small. With a 6.7-inch AMOLED display and a slim, lightweight design, it weighs just 186 grams and is 7.8 millimeters thick. Its price is a little higher than that of the Galaxy S20, as expected, but lower than that of the S20 Ultra, plus it is available in different shades: Cosmic Gray, Cosmic Black and Cloud Blue.

Other attractions are its 120 Hz refresh rate and 3,200 x 1,440 pixel resolution, elements that give their best when it comes to browsing different applications and playing streaming content, for example.

Although the processor may be different, depending on where you buy it, the S20 Plus is a powerful smartphone . In the United States, it’s ready with the Snapdragon 865 chip, while in the UK and Europe, with Samsung’s Exynos 990. It incorporates 8 GB of RAM and 128 GB of storage.

The phone itself, regardless of its processor, is lightweight and doesn’t heat up when playing, even when the settings are at their peak.

Its 4,500 mAh battery should be enough to easily go through a full day of heavy use, where gaming and video viewing are not ruled out. What about your optics? The 64 megapixel telephoto lens offers a 3x optical zoom, and there is a time of flight sensor and a 12 megapixel ultra wide-angle camera. Regarding its night mode, it gives good results, and there is also no complaint with its 8K video recording and Single Take mode, which records photos and videos using all the cameras of the phone (it is ideal for those moments when you can not decide whether to share still image or clips on social media).

The S20 Plus is also 5G ready, for when this technology is extended to more regions, while still being compatible with existing networks.

Finalist: Samsung Galaxy S20

Teléfono Galaxy S20

If your budget is out of the S20 Plus, the Galaxy S20 is an excellent alternative that costs around $ 300 less. With a slightly smaller screen (6.2 inches), it has the same processor as the S20 Plus, although it incorporates a 4,000 mAh battery and the rear camera is triple, not quad. It also weighs a bit less (163 grams), so if you prefer a more compact and lightweight phone, the S20 is likely the answer.

The best for productivity

Samsung Galaxy Note 10 Plus

Why you should buy it: This is a sleek phone with an impressive 6.8-inch dynamic AMOLED display and useful productivity features.

Who’s it for : For any user who takes notes on their smartphone and wants something beyond the standard features.

Although it is taller and wider than the Note 9 (for what will surely require both hands), the Galaxy Note 10 Plus is quite thin and light, weighing 196 grams. If you have the chance, choose the Aura Glow color, as it has a striking iridescent finish. It integrates a dynamic 6.8-inch AMOLED screen with a resolution of 3,040 x 1,440, in addition to HDR10 + certification. Of course, its refresh rate is 60 Hz, which could be a bit disappointing for some.

The same thing that happens with other cell phones of the firm: if you buy it in the United States, it includes the Snapdragon 855 processor, while in other regions, the Exynos 9825. The chip is complemented by 12 GB of RAM, which means a good performance in multitasking. Regarding storage, you can choose the 256 or 512 GB configuration.

Samsung put in a 4,300 mAh battery, which should be enough for a full day. Also, the phone comes with a 25 watt charger that supports Quick Charge 2.0, so it takes at least 60 minutes to fully charge. There’s also a separate 45-watt charger, which delivers 100 percent in 30 minutes.

The Note 10 Plus does not disappoint in its triple camera either: 12 megapixel main lens, 12 megapixel telephoto and 16 megapixel ultra wide angle, plus the time of flight sensor. It’s fun to play around with some of the Live Focus effects; Color Point, for example, makes the background black and white, while the subject remains in its original color.

The S Pen integrates some new features. Air Actions makes it possible to move the pen like a wand to control applications, while AR Doodle allows you to draw in 3D using the phone’s camera. On the productivity side, the write-to-text conversion feature will come in handy for many, although this only works with Word, plus the text is placed in a text box, so you’ll need to cut and paste it for editing.

The standard Galaxy Note 10 Plus is not 5G ready; It only supports Wi-Fi 6 and LTE. You can buy this version right now on Amazon, for a price of less than $ 900 dollars.

Finalist: Samsung Galaxy Note 10

The Galaxy Note 10 will cost you around $ 150 less than the Note 10 Plus. Weighing only 168 grams, it was designed with a 6.3-inch screen and a 2,280 x 1,080-pixel resolution. It has three main lenses, 8GB of RAM and the same processor as its “big brother”. Although it only has a 3,500 mAh battery, it comes with a 25-watt charger and supports wireless charging (15 watts). Note 10 is worth considering if you prefer a smaller alternative to Note 10 Plus.

The best under $ 500

Samsung Galaxy A51

Why you should buy it: it is an excellent proposal in the mid-range, with an elegant design, good OLED screen and quad main camera.

Who’s it for : For those looking for quality, but without having to spend as much, as well as for those looking for an alternative to the new iPhone SE.

Why we chose the Galaxy A51 here: For less than $ 500, this phone is hard to beat. Its 6.5-inch OLED display and slim bezels give it a sleek look, plus it’s also lightweight. We especially recommend the blue shade and adding a microSD card to expand its base storage, 128 GB, up to 512 GB.

The smartphone comes with the Exynos 9611, which can be compared to the Snapdragon 665, while its RAM is 4 GB, elements that allow for an outstanding gaming experience. Interestingly, we have found that you can experience some lag with more basic tasks.

In a mix between mid-range and upper-midrange, it includes a physical input for headphones and an on-screen optical scanner that generally responds quite well. Quad camera includes 48-megapixel primary sensor, 12-megapixel ultra-wide angle, 5-megapixel depth lens, and 5-megapixel macro sensor to cover any photography need (although focusing in low light can be a problem ).

The Galaxy A51 ships with Android 10 out of the box, but features the One UI customization layer. Also, its 4,000 mAh battery should be enough for most of the day.

Although the basic model is not compatible with the fifth generation of mobile connection, the A51 5G version is available.

Finalist: Samsung Galaxy A70

Currently available for less than $ 350 on Amazon, the Samsung Galaxy A70 comes with Android 9 Pie and features a 6.7-inch Super AMOLED display, Snapdragon 675 processor, 6GB RAM and 128GB of storage. If you add to this a triple camera and a 4,500 mAh battery that supports fast charging (25 watts), you have an impressive smartphone for less than $ 500 dollars.
